How to Change DNS Settings on Mac

Just like Windows, it is also quite similar to perform on Apple’s Mac operating system.

  • Starting with Opening Apple Menu, and then head over to System preference.
  • Click on the Network, and then if the lock-icon appears on the lower-left corner then click on that icon to continue. Enter your password to confirm you want to make changes.
  • After that, Choose the network you want to make changes with and then enter the DNS you want to use on your system.
  • There are two different ways to perform for Wifi, and Ethernet, Follow the following instruction.
  • Wi-Fi: Click on Wi-Fi and then select advance.
  • Ethernet: Click on Build-in Ethernet and then select Advance.
  • Next, Click on Ok and then Select Apply.
  • That’s it, now you continue working.

How to Change DNS on Router

Likewise, other settings changing on Router is similar. For this, it usally depends upon the manufacture. So just find the settings and then look what’s fit the best.

  • Open Router admin console, and then enter the password to confinue.
  • After that, simply Click on Edit Network settings and then look for DNS box.
  • Enter the DNS you want to use, Fill the Primiary and Secound DNS Server box.
  • Click on Save, and then Exit.
  • Restart your browser and that’s it, you have successfully configure changing DNS settings.

How to change DNS on iPhone or iPad.

As Android, Apple are also allowing us to change our DNS servers or network in spite of we cannot set that DNS server which we preferred to use all around. In iOS we can only change DNS for Wi-Fi individually in the custom name server setting.

  • Now, steps for changing DNS server in iPhone or iPad.
  • As always firstly go to the settings and select Wi-Fi.
  • Click on I button which is present on the right side of your Wi-Fi network which you want to configure it.
  • Scrolling down and select on the configure DNS option in setting.
  • Now click on manual and pull out that DNS network address by tap over on the red minus button that you do not want to use from the list.
  • For add the DNS address which you want to use then tap on green plus button. We can also put these both IPv4 and IPv6 addresses.
  • Now click on save button.

We can also restore our default DNS server setting by tapping on Automatic.
